Win11虚拟机性能提升难题解析

win11虚拟机性能低

时间:2025-01-23 13:51


Win11虚拟机性能低下:深度剖析与应对策略 在科技日新月异的今天,操作系统作为连接硬件与软件的桥梁,其性能表现直接关系到用户体验与工作效率

    Windows 11(以下简称Win11),作为微软最新推出的操作系统,自发布以来便备受瞩目

    然而,不少用户在使用Win11虚拟机时遇到了性能瓶颈问题,这不仅影响了日常操作流畅度,也给专业应用、软件开发及测试等领域带来了挑战

    本文旨在深入剖析Win11虚拟机性能低下的原因,并提出一系列有效的应对策略,以期帮助用户优化使用体验

     一、Win11虚拟机性能低下的现象概述 虚拟机(Virtual Machine, VM)技术允许在一台物理机上运行多个操作系统实例,极大地提高了资源利用率和灵活性

    然而,当用户尝试在虚拟机中运行Win11时,往往会发现相较于原生安装,系统响应速度变慢、应用程序加载时间长、图形渲染延迟增加等问题

    这些性能下降的表现,不仅限于个人用户日常娱乐,更在专业领域如软件开发、云计算服务、测试环境搭建等方面造成了显著影响

     二、性能低下原因分析 1.硬件资源分配不足:虚拟机性能很大程度上依赖于分配给它的CPU核心数、内存大小以及磁盘I/O性能

    若这些资源分配不足,Win11虚拟机自然难以发挥最佳性能

    特别是在多任务处理或运行资源密集型应用时,资源争用尤为明显

     2.虚拟化开销:虚拟化技术虽然强大,但也会引入一定的性能开销

    虚拟化层需要对指令进行翻译、模拟硬件设备等操作,这些过程都会消耗额外的计算资源

    对于Win11这样资源需求较高的系统,虚拟化开销显得尤为突出

     3.图形处理性能受限:Win11在图形界面和动画效果上进行了大量优化,这对虚拟机的图形处理能力提出了更高要求

    然而,虚拟显卡的性能往往远低于物理显卡,尤其是在3D渲染、视频编辑等高负载场景下,性能瓶颈尤为明显

     4.驱动程序兼容性:虚拟机中的操作系统依赖于宿主机的虚拟化驱动来与虚拟硬件交互

    如果Win11的某些关键组件或第三方软件驱动程序与虚拟化环境不兼容,可能导致性能下降甚至系统不稳定

     5.安全与更新策略:Win11自带的安全增强功能和频繁的系统更新,虽然提升了安全性,但有时也会因兼容性问题或资源占用过多而影响虚拟机性能

     三、应对策略与优化建议 针对上述问题,以下是一些提升Win11虚拟机性能的有效策略: 1.合理分配硬件资源: -CPU与内存:根据实际需求,尽可能为虚拟机分配更多的CPU核心和内存

    注意平衡宿主机的资源需求,避免过度分配导致宿主机性能下降

     -磁盘I/O:使用SSD作为虚拟机存储介质,可以显著提升读写速度

    同时,启用虚拟机的磁盘缓存机制,减少I/O等待时间

     2.选择高效虚拟化平台: - 不同虚拟化软件(如VMware Workstation、VirtualBox、Hyper-V等)在性能优化上各有千秋

    选择一款与Win11兼容性更好、性能表现更优的虚拟化平台至关重要

     - 确保虚拟化平台及所有相关组件均为最新版本,以享受最新的性能优化和漏洞修复

     3.优化图形处理: - 利用虚拟化平台提供的硬件加速功能,如VMware的DirectPath I/O(DPIO)或Hyper-V的离散设备分配(DDA),将物理显卡的部分资源直接分配给虚拟机,提升图形处理能力

     - 对于不需要复杂图形界面的应用场景,可以考虑降低虚拟机中的图形设置,减少图形渲染负担

     4.解决驱动程序兼容性问题: - 定期检查并更新虚拟化平台的工具和驱动程序,确保它们与Win11的最新版本兼容

     - 对于特定的第三方软件,尝试寻找或请求开发商提供针对虚拟化环境的优化版本

     5.调整安全与更新策略: - 在虚拟机中合理配置Windows Defender等安全软件,避免不必要的实时监控和扫描影响性能

     - 考虑在非生产环境中延迟更新,待微软发布稳定补丁后再进行升级,以减少因更新带来的兼容性问题

     6.应用级优化: - 在虚拟机内关闭不必要的后台服务和启动项,减少系统资源占用

     - 使用轻量级的应用程序和工具,避免在虚拟机中运行资源密集型的大型软件,特别是那些对图形处理能力要求高的应用

     7.监控与调优: - 利用虚拟化平台提供的性能监控工具,定期分析虚拟机的资源使用情况,识别性能瓶颈

     - 根据监控结果,动态调整资源分配策略,如增加CPU核心数、内存大小或优化磁盘配置

     四、结论 Win11虚拟机性能低下是一个复杂的问题,涉及硬件资源分配、虚拟化技术特性、图形处理能力、驱动程序兼容性以及安全与更新策略等多个方面

    通过合理配置硬件资源、选择高效虚拟化平台、优化图形处理、解决驱动程序兼容性问题、调整安全与更新策略、应用级优化以及持续监控与调优,可以显著提升Win11虚拟机的性能表现

    尽管完全消除虚拟化带来的性能开销是不可能的,但通过上述策略,我们可以最大限度地减少其对用户体验的影响,让Win11虚拟机成为高效、稳定的工作平台

    随着虚拟化技术的不断进步和Win11系统的持续优化,未来虚拟机性能表现有望进一步提升,为用户带来更加流畅的使用体验